Surviving Sanctity by Janet Cobb
Abandoned by her father and raised by a staunch Catholic mother, Janet seeks to make amends for her troubled teen years and to find a purpose for her pain. Janet subjects her rebellious spirit to the whims of an oppressive Mother Superior, immersing herself in the constructed reality of Roman Catholic convent life in the 1980s to serve God as Sister Mary Jude. Living in three countries and speaking three languages, she packs into thirteen years what many never experience in a lifetime. She dines with bishops and beggars, washes the feet of the poor, and holds hands with the mentally ill. All while ignoring the gnawing dysfunction of her religious surroundings. As the truth surrounding her father unravels, certainties shatter and life becomes a muddled question, forcing her to face her own truth. Surviving Sanctity is dedicated to those who suffer with depression. A portion of royalties will support the nonprofit organization Project Semicolon-because your story isn't over yet.
Janet Cobb has no regrets. Admitting you can take Janet out of the convent, but you can't take the convent out of Janet, she rejects fear and manipulation, and continually seeks courage to reclaim her sanity and her soul. Janet finds the grace to be resilient through cooking, writing, teaching, and channeling her creativity into impactful projects. She is grateful for the loving challenge and support from her husband and three children.
